    European natural gas prices surge over 16% amid U.S.-Iran tensions

    Here's what it means for you.

    Rising natural gas prices may impact energy costs for consumers and businesses across Europe.

    What happened

    European natural gas prices are set to rise by more than 16% this week amid geopolitical tensions.

    The Context

    • Tensions in the Strait of Hormuz are affecting global energy supplies.
    • Stalled U.S.-Iran talks are contributing to market uncertainty.
    • Natural gas prices are sensitive to geopolitical events, impacting consumer costs.

    Takeaway

    The ongoing geopolitical tensions may lead to further volatility in natural gas prices in the coming weeks.
